Find the volume of a cylinder whose r = 3.5 cm, h = 40 cm .

टिप्पणी लिखिए

उत्तर

\[ \text{ Given }: \]
\[r = 3 . 5 \text{ cm, h = 40 cm } \]
\[\text{ Volume of cylinder, } V = \pi r^2 h\]
\[ = \frac{22}{7} \times \left( 3 . 5 \right)^2 \times 40\]
\[ = 1540 {\text{ cm } }^3 \]
